diff options
| author | jules <jules@okfoc.us> | 2014-01-01 19:36:47 -0500 |
|---|---|---|
| committer | jules <jules@okfoc.us> | 2014-01-01 19:36:47 -0500 |
| commit | 468ed78c18fea799091dd9c0e638beff24c6b7aa (patch) | |
| tree | 761ff72a711809984aa59e6907dff768ce279054 | |
| parent | dd346d3b62bf58bc3fc20506f890f64b79609596 (diff) | |
username fix
| -rw-r--r-- | js/user.js | 7 | ||||
| -rw-r--r-- | shader-picker.html | 4 |
2 files changed, 7 insertions, 4 deletions
@@ -1,12 +1,15 @@ var user = new function(){} user.init = function(){ - user.username = user.getCookie() - $("#username").val(user.username) + user.load() user.bind() } user.bind = function(){ $("#username").on("input", user.save) } +user.load = function(){ + user.username = user.getCookie() + $("#username").val(user.username) +} user.sanitize = function(){ return $("#username").val().replace(/[^-_ a-zA-Z0-9]/g,"") } diff --git a/shader-picker.html b/shader-picker.html index 9c3f50c..4024583 100644 --- a/shader-picker.html +++ b/shader-picker.html @@ -448,7 +448,7 @@ encoder.on("rendered-url", function(url){ function get_filename(){ var basename = $("#url").val().replace(/^.*\//,"").replace(/\..*$/,"").replace(/[^-_ a-zA-Z0-9]/g,"") - var username = get_username() + var username = user.username var filename = basename + "-" + username + "-" + (+new Date()) + ".gif" return filename.replace(/ /g,"_").replace(/-+/g,"-") } @@ -461,7 +461,7 @@ function save (){ function upload(){ var filename = get_filename() - var username = get_username() + var username = user.username var blob = dataUriToBlob(lastGif) uploadImage({ blob: blob, |
